Rebalancer Plugin Basics

Welcome to the Spokewise plugin program. Spokewise computes nightly rebalancing plans for the Calder Bay bike-share network, and plugins let you customize scoring — for example, weighting docks near the Ferrow transit hub. Plugins run sandboxed, receive read-only station snapshots, and must return within 500 ms. Review the manifest schema before submitting; malformed manifests are rejected silently. For API access and submission questions, write to the plugin desk below.

pager mailbox: silael.sorwyn.tamius@zemvarsys.corp

- [ ] Before the Quillhaven signing ceremony proceeds, run the leaked-file-descriptor hunt on the offline signer. As a new contractor, please be thorough: enumerate every open descriptor on the sealed host, confirm nothing points at the ceremony scratch volume, and log each finding in the Larkspur register. If any descriptor traces back to the retired Fenwick exporter, halt and page the ceremony lead. Once the host shows a clean descriptor table, unlock the escrow envelope using the phrase below.

unlock words, yajof-tagef: aldiel-kasath-briax-fraeth-pelius-olieth-pelix-wenius-wenael-norael

Leadership Review Briefing — Branch Managers. Quick heads-up on the Pellwright launch plan. We're targeting a staggered rollout: flagship branches first, then regional sites two weeks later. Demo kits arrive by end of month, and each branch gets a short training video plus a cheat sheet for common questions. Marketing runs local promos in week one; keep displays front and center. Early orders count toward the quarterly bonus pool, so push hard. The thinking behind the timing is laid out in the note below.

internal memo for tajof-kaduf: Only 65 of the 511 pilot accounts renewed Lamdor, so a churn review is set for January 26. Aldmirek Works is in early talks to buy Alddorox Works for about $490.9 million.

Runbook: PedalShift account recovery. If the rebalancing dispatcher account for PedalShift gets locked after failed logins, do not create a new operator account — route assignments will orphan. Instead, trigger the recovery flow from the Dockside admin console and confirm the lockout window has expired. The recovery passphrase for the dispatcher vault is as follows.

recovery phrase for yawep-yajof: holox-wenwyn-aldion-quenael-istiel